数字地图注记自动定位方法的智能优化
详细信息    本馆镜像全文|  推荐本文 |  |   获取CNKI官网全文
摘要
近年来,随着经济建设的快速发展,人们对地图的应用越来越广泛,要求也越来越高,地图更新的速度越来越快,从而使地图注记自动配置就显得尤为重要。除此以外,计算机、网络和信息技术的发展,促使世界各国加快了测绘技术信息化进程。如何利用计算机进行地图注记自动配置,提高地图生产效率,已经成为影响和制约GIS应用和发展的一个迫切需要解决的问题。本论文目的在于提高地图自动注记系统的自动化程度和注记质量,降低人工干预和人工编辑的作业量,力求解决实际生产中的问题,促使地图注记自动配置研究成果实用化。
     本文首先深入了解了当前国内外地图自动注记的研究动态,在详细阐述了地图注记配置的理论、方法、规则的基础上,对现有的方法进行分析研究,重点讨论了在地形图中的占主要比例的点状要素,道路、河流、等高线等线状要素,以及居民地、湖泊等面状要素的注记自动配置的推理方法,并给出了相应的实现算法。
     对应用在注记自动配置中的人工智能算法进行了讨论,简单介绍了禁忌搜索算法,重点论述了人工神经网络和遗传算法。并分析了各算法的优缺点。
     在研究过程中,为了实际需要把网格划分,遗传算法,拓扑等方法运用到算法设计和实现的过程中,对算法本身进行了优化,提高了计算效率。对算法的优化和完善是本文所研究的核心重点。
     最后,对研究内容进行了实践检测,将所采用或设计的方法用C#和VC++结合编程实现并应用到NewMap DMP制图软件中,完成其注记的自动配置系统。
In recent years, with the rapid development of economic construction, it is widely applied on the map, thus, requiring much more high-quality and efficiency of map contents updates, which has made automatical configuration of the map notes become particularly important. In addition, computer, network and information technology have led many countries to accelerate the process of information-based of surveying and mapping technology. How to use computers process the Automated Placement of map notes and improve the efficiency of map production has already become a key factor and issue needed to solved imminently, which has also influenced and restricted the application and development of Geographic Information System (GIS). The purpose of this paper is to improve the quality of map notes and the degree of the automatic map notes system, reduce the amount of work of human intervention and manual editing, strive to solve practical problems in the production and also prompt the practicality of the production of map auto-configuration research.
     Firstly, in-depth understanding of the current domestic and international research dynamics on map automated placement, elaborated on the map in the configuration note the theory, methods, rules, based on existing methods of analysis and research focused on the topographic map accounted for the major proportion of the point feature, roads, rivers, contour lines and other linear elements, as well as residential areas, lakes and other area feature automatic configuration Note reasoning, and the corresponding algorithm.
     Notes on the application of the automatic configuration of the artificial intelligence algorithms were discussed, a brief introduction of the tabu search algorithm, with emphasis on artificial neural networks and genetic algorithms. And analyzes the advantages and disadvantages of each method. In the course of the study, to the actual needs of the mesh, genetic algorithms, topology and other methods applied to algorithm design and implementation process of the algorithm itself has been optimized to improve the computational efficiency. Optimization and improvement of the algorithm is the core focus of this paper.
     Finally, the practice test was carried out on the research contents of this paper by programming with VC++, methods and algorithms of the results of research work was applied to the NewMap DMP mapping software, accomplishing its auto-configuration system on map notes.
引文
[1]周继成,周青山,韩飘扬.人工神经网络——第六代计算机的实现[M].北京:科学普及出版社,1993.
    [2]张立明.人工神经网络的模型及其应用[M].上海:复旦大学出版社,1993.
    [3] Hopfield J J. Neurons with graded response have collective compuatation properties like those of two state neurons. Proc. Natl. Acad. Sci. U. S. A., 1984, 81(5):3088-3092.
    [4]张青贵.人工神经网络导论[M].北京:中国水利水电出版社,2004.
    [5]陈允平.人工神经网络原理及其应用[M].北京:中国电力出版社,2002.
    [6]马锐.人工神经网络原理[M].北京:机械工业出版社,2010.
    [7]丁士圻,郭丽华.人工神经网络基础[M].哈尔滨:哈尔滨工程大学,2008.
    [8]梁学斌,吴立德.Hopfield型神经网络的全局指数稳定性及应用.中国科学(A),1995,25(2):523-532.
    [9]廖晓昕.论Hopfield神经网络的数学内蕴.中国科学(E),2003,32(2):127-136.
    [10] Miller W T.Real-time application of neural networks for sensor-based control of robots with vision[J].IEEE Trans.System,Man,Cybern.,1989,(19):825-831.
    [11]焦李成.神经网络计算[M].西安:西安电子科技大学出版社,1993.
    [12]魏海坤.神经网络结构设计的理论与方法[M].北京:国防工业出版社,2005.
    [13]米凯利维茨Z[美].演化程序——遗传算法和数据编码的结合[M].北京:科学出版社,2000.
    [14]邢文训,谢金星.现代优化计算方法[M].北京:清华大学出版社,2003.
    [15] Gen M,Cheng R W.Genetic algorithms and engineering design[M].New York:John Wiley and Sons,1997.
    [16] Grefenstette J J.Optimization of Control Parameters for Genetic Algorithms[M]. IEEE Trans. on AMC,1986,16(1),122-128.
    [17]张文修,梁怡.遗传算法的数学基础[M].西安:西安交通大学出版社,2000.
    [18]王小平,曹立明.遗传算法——理论、应用与软件实现[M].西安:西安交通大学出版社,2002.
    [19]王凌.智能优化算法及其应用[M].北京:清华大学出版社,2001.
    [20]周明,孙树栋.遗传算法原理及应用[M].北京:国防工业出版社,2002.
    [21]蔡自兴,徐光佑.人工智能及其应用[M].北京:清华大学出版社,2003.
    [22]普雷帕拉塔F P,沙莫斯M I.计算几何[M].北京:科学出版社,1992.
    [23] AH罗宾逊等.地图学原理[M].北京:测绘出版社,1989.
    [24]黄杏元,马劲松,汤勤.地理信息系统概论[M].北京:高等教育出版社,1990.
    [25]郭达志,盛业华,余兆平.地理信息系统基础与应用[M].北京:煤炭工业出版社.
    [26]樊红,刘开军,张祖勋.基于遗传算法的点状要素注记的整体最优配置[M].武汉大学学报,2002,27(6):560-565.
    [27]贾伟凤,曾囡莉,廖晓昕.关于Hopfield型神经网络稳定性的注记[J].华中科技大学学报,2003,31(8),74-76.
    [28]樊红,张祖勋,杜道生等.基于神经网络模型求取注记配置最优解[J].武汉测绘科技大学学报,1998,23(1):32-35.
    [29]刘树安,吕帅.地图文本注记问题的遗传算法求解[J].控制工程,2007,14(2),129-131.
    [30]张红武,张友纯,谢忠等.用遗传算法解决点状要素的自动注记问题[J].计算机工程与应用,2003,7,68-77.
    [31]韩炜,廖振鹏.关于遗传算法收敛性的注记[J].地震工程与工程振动,1999,19(4),13-16.
    [32]杨勇,邓淑丹,李霖等.基于禁忌搜索的点状注记研究[J].测绘科学,2007,32(6),46-48.
    [33]郑春燕,郭庆胜,刘小利。基于禁忌搜索算法的点状要素注记的自动配置[J].武汉大学学报,2006,31(5),428-431.
    [34]樊红,杜道生,张祖勋.地图注记自动配置规则及其实现策略[J].武汉测绘科技大学学报,1998,24(2),154-157.
    [35]贾新宇,陆志一. Polyline线的抽稀与圆滑[J].信息技术,2006,2006,7,145-146.
    [36]樊红,张祖勋,杜道生.地图注记质量评价模型的研究[J].测绘学报,2004,33(4),362-366.
    [37]贺彪,李霖,朱海红.数字制图中面状注记自动配置的研究[J].测绘信息与工程,2007,32(6),12-14.
    [38]刘小利.城市地形图注记自动配置子系统的设计与实现[D].武汉大学硕士学位论文,2005.
    [39]雷明军.地图线状要素注记自动配置的研究[D].武汉大学硕士学位论文,2005.
    [40]耿留勇.地图注记自动配置研究及其在AutoCAD地图制图中的应用[D].成都理工大学硕士学位论文,2007.
    [41]娄倩.电子地图动态注记的设计与实现[D].解放军信息工程大学硕士学位论文,2007.
    [42]杨凌云.电子地图动态注记的研究和实现[D].中国地质大学硕士学位论文,2007.
    [43]樊红.地图注记自动配置研究[M].北京:测绘出版社,2004
    [44]邓红艳,武芳,李铭等.遗传算法在点注记自动配置中的应用[J].测绘学院学报,2003,20(1),69-72.
    [45]吴信才.地理信息系统的基本技术与发展动态[J].地球科学,1998,23(4),329-333.
    [46] HumPhreys P,Freedman D.The grand leap[J].British Journal for the Philosophy of science,1999,47,113-118.
    [47] Hnas Pual Schwefel,Frank Kusrwae.Solving Map Labeling Problems by Means of Evolution Strategies[J].Diplomarbeit Fachbeerieh Informatik der Universitat Dortmumd.1998,2(19),1-73.
    [48] James E M.Automated Feature and Name Placement On Parallel Computers[J]. Cartography and Geographic Information Systems,1993,20(2),69-82.
    [49] YOeli P.The Logic of Auotmated Map Lettering[J].The Cartogrphical Journal,1972,9(2),99-108.
    [50] Cook A C,Jones C B.A Prolog Rule2Based System for Cartographic Name Placement[J]. Computer Graphics Forum,1990,9(2),109-126.
    [51] Steven Zoraster.Integer Programming Applied To The Map Label Placement Problem[J].Cartographic a,1986,23(3),16-27.

© 2004-2018 中国地质图书馆版权所有 京ICP备05064691号 京公网安备11010802017129号

地址:北京市海淀区学院路29号 邮编:100083

电话:办公室:(+86 10)66554848;文献借阅、咨询服务、科技查新:66554700